    Is Dead By Daylight Crossplay? Understanding Cross-Progression

    “Dead by Daylight” is a popular multiplayer horror game that pits one player as a killer against four survivors who are trying to escape. With its growing fanbase, many players are curious about the game’s crossplay and cross-progression features. This article (Is Dead By Daylight Crossplay) will delve into these aspects to help you better understand what “Dead by Daylight” offers.

    What is Crossplay?

    Crossplay, also known as cross-platform play, allows gamers to play together regardless of the platform they are using. This means that a player on an Xbox can join a game with a friend who is playing on a PlayStation or PC. Crossplay broadens the pool of players, reduces wait times, and enhances the overall gaming experience.

    Does Dead By Daylight Support Crossplay?

    Dead By Daylight

    Yes, “Dead by Daylight” does support crossplay. As of August 2020, Behaviour Interactive, the developer of the game, enabled crossplay between PC, Xbox One, PlayStation 4, and Nintendo Switch. This feature allows players on these platforms to join games together, making it easier to play with friends and meet new players.

    The introduction of crossplay has been a significant milestone for the game, as it has unified the player base and improved matchmaking times. However, it is essential to note that mobile versions of the game do not support crossplay with console and PC versions.

    Dead By Daylight Switch Crossplay

    For those wondering specifically about the Nintendo Switch version, the answer is yes—”Dead by Daylight” on the Switch supports crossplay. This inclusion means that Switch players can join games with those on PC, Xbox One, and PlayStation 4. This feature ensures that Switch players are not isolated from the larger community and can enjoy the full multiplayer experience.

    What is Cross-Progression?

    Cross-progression allows players to carry their game progress, including unlocked characters, cosmetics, and other in-game items, across different platforms. This feature is particularly useful for players who own the game on multiple platforms or switch between devices frequently.

    Does Dead By Daylight Support Cross-Progression?

    Tomb Rider in Dead By Daylight

    As of now, “Dead by Daylight” offers limited cross-progression. Currently, cross-progression is available between Steam and Google Stadia. This means that players can transfer their progress between these two platforms seamlessly.

    Behaviour Interactive has expressed interest in expanding cross-progression to other platforms, but there are no confirmed plans or timelines for this feature’s broader implementation. Players should stay tuned for any future announcements regarding cross-progression capabilities.

    Conclusion

    To sum up, “Dead by Daylight” supports crossplay across PC, Xbox One, PlayStation 4, and Nintendo Switch, allowing players to enjoy the game with friends regardless of their platform. While cross-progression is currently limited to Steam and Google Stadia, there is hope that this feature will expand to other platforms in the future.

    Whether you are a new player or a seasoned survivor, these features enhance the overall gaming experience, making “Dead by Daylight” even more enjoyable. Keep an eye out for updates from Behaviour Interactive to stay informed about any new developments.
